Audi Q7 3.0 TDI quattro 204PS arrives in the UK
Wed, 14 Dec 2011Audi Q7 3.0 TDI quattro 204PS now available Audi has launched the Q7 3.0 TDI quattro 204PS in to the UK with 39.2mpg and reducing CO2 to 189g/km. Starts at £39,995. A less powerful engine for the Audi Q7 isn’t the first thing that jumps to mind as the right way to go, but Audi thinks there’s a market.
Non-starting Nissan LEAFs to be reprogrammed
Sun, 17 Apr 2011NIssan LEAF - date with a laptop They’re not exactly thick on the ground but, as we reported just a week ago, Nissan has already got problems with the Nissan LEAF, which has been refusing to restart once it’s stopped. Not restarting is not exactly a safety issue, so as long as you can actually get your nice new Nissan LEAF to start in the first place there’s no chance it will pack up on you mid-journey (unless you run out of electrickery). But having stumped up at least £10k more than an equivalent ICE car would cost for your LEAF, the least you should be able to expect is it to do what it says on the tin without packing up.
Citroen C4 Picasso
Mon, 14 Aug 2006Citroen has released pictures of their new midi-MPV, the C4 Picasso, which will make its debut in Paris next month. The design mixes C4 hatchback and the C-AirLounge concept with broken lines and full surfaces that have come to define contemporary Citroens. A total glass area of 6.4sqm (including optional sunroof) promises excellent visibility from what is claimed to be class-leading interior space.
